Types of Apartments in Greenwood Heights
The best Greenwood Heights apartments homes come in a variety of styles, catering to different preferences and needs. From classic brownstones to contemporary condos, there's something for everyone in this neighborhood. Let's take a closer look at the types of housing available:
Brownstone Apartments
Brownstones are a hallmark of Brooklyn's architectural heritage, and Greenwood Heights is no exception. These historic buildings often feature spacious layouts, high ceilings, and original details like wood-burning fireplaces and ornate moldings. Many brownstone apartments have been renovated to include modern amenities while preserving their classic charm.
Loft Apartments
Loft apartments are another popular option in Greenwood Heights. Formerly industrial spaces, these units now boast open floor plans, exposed brick walls, and large windows that let in plenty of natural light. They are ideal for those who appreciate a more industrial aesthetic.

Price Range and Budgeting
When it comes to the best Greenwood Heights apartments homes, pricing can vary significantly depending on the type of housing and its amenities. On average, studio apartments start at around $2,500 per month, while one-bedroom units can range from $3,000 to $4,000. Larger apartments, such as two or three bedrooms, can go up to $6,000 or more.
Factors Affecting Pricing
Several factors influence the price of apartments in Greenwood Heights:
- Location within the neighborhood
- Size and layout of the apartment
- Included amenities and services
- Age and condition of the building
It's important to set a budget and consider additional costs, such as utilities, insurance, and maintenance fees, when planning your move to Greenwood Heights.

Commuting Options in Greenwood Heights
Greenwood Heights offers convenient access to various modes of transportation, making it an ideal location for commuters. Whether you prefer public transit, biking, or driving, you'll find plenty of options to get around the city.
Public Transit
Residents of Greenwood Heights can take advantage of nearby subway lines, including the F, G, and R trains, which provide easy access to Manhattan and other parts of Brooklyn. Additionally, multiple bus routes serve the area, offering additional flexibility for commuters.
Biking and Driving
For those who prefer biking or driving, Greenwood Heights is well-connected to major bike paths and roadways. The nearby Gowanus Expressway provides quick access to other parts of the city, while the Brooklyn Bike Path offers a scenic route for cyclists.
